im doing a plumbing course and wanted to know what my gas meter is ie u6, e6 or g4, there is nothing that says on the meter thats its any of those, how do i find out what it is?
Think of E6, U6 and U16 as just the size of the box
The 6 or 16 is their rated measuring ability in cubic metres/hour. Even if it's slightly different
You'll see "U6" size meters with R5, G4, and all sorts on them.
